  "account": "The battery capacity of the upcoming iPhone 18 Pro has been uncovered by iFixit, who shared their findings with Tom's Guide. Traditionally, Apple does not officially disclose the battery capacity specifications for their iPhones, except for the headline figure of up to 45 hours of video playback. Through their teardown, iFixit determined that the North American iPhone 18 Pro is equipped with a 4,288mAh battery. This represents a mere 1% increase from the iPhone 17 Pro's 4,252 mAh battery. In practical terms, this slight boost translates to an additional hour of battery life, stretching the iPhone 18 Pro's endurance to 16 hours and 17 minutes, compared to the 17 Pro's 15 hours and 17 minutes.
